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Lanark to Cooksbridge start from as little as £58.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Lanark to Cooksbridge start from £143.00 one way, or £204.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Lanark to Cooksbridge are available for £224.20 one way, or £448.40 return

Welcome to Lanark Train Station

Nestled in the heart of Scotland, Lanark train station is your gateway to exploring both rural charm and urban excitement. This station might not be the largest but it’s brimming with convenient features and friendly services designed to make your journey seamless and comfortable.

Facilities and Amenities

Lanark station offers a variety of facilities catering to both everyday commuters and occasional travelers. The ticket office is open Monday to Saturday from 06:20 to 20:25, providing ample time for travelers to buy and collect tickets. Although there are no Sunday services, the ticket machines onsite remain available for fast and accessible service for collecting tickets purchased online.

Accessibility is a top priority at Lanark station. It's categorized as a Category A station, offering step-free access throughout, although care should be taken at platform 1 due to potential height differences. While the station doesn’t feature accessible toilets or lounges, there are three Blue Badge parking bays available in the 24-hour freely available car park that has CCTV security for added peace of mind.

Support and Accessibility Services

The station is equipped with customer help points and an induction loop for those with hearing impairments, ensuring support is on hand if needed. Should you require assistance, staff help is available throughout the week, and additional help can be scheduled in advance via the Passenger Assist Service.

Facilities and Amenities at Cooksbridge Station

Though quaint, Cooksbridge train station is equipped with essential amenities, ensuring a smooth transit experience. In terms of ticketing, while there's no staffed ticket office, automated 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ting prepaid tickets. These are accessible for users with disabilities, supporting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Despite the lack of a waiting room or refreshment facilities, passengers can find seating areas on site to rest while awaiting their trains.

Step-free access is partially available, with separate entrances to each platform and a street-level crossing providing easy access between platforms. To ensure a barrier-free experience, an assistance meeting point is situated on platform 2, which offers additional support.

Though Cooksbridge lacks provisions such as toilets, baby changing facilities, and shops, safety measures are in place with CCTV and on-platform help points providing important security and customer service support. As part of its commitment to inclusivity, assistance for passengers requiring extra help is available through pre-booked services or on-the-spot assistance via help points, ensuring a seamless journey for all.
